Showing the task board
To show the task board on the Bimplus portal
Go to the left sidebar and click Show task board.
You can see the task board above the full view. The table lists the tasks created for the Bimplus project, including the most important task details.
By using the Task navigator palette on the left side, you can categorize the tasks, find tasks and control how the tasks look in the table of the task board.
Retrieving tasks
To use the Bimplus portal to retrieve tasks created for a Bimplus project
- Show the task board (see "Showing the task board").
Go to the task board or the Task navigator palette and click the task of which you want to see details.
The Details palette opens on the right side.
At the same time, full view displays the view of the building model that was saved together with the task. In addition, all required specialist models, object types and structural levels of the building structure will be selected automatically.
Creating tasks
To use the Bimplus portal to create a new task
- Select an appropriate view of the building model in full view. Make sure all required objects are visible. This view will be saved together with the new task.
Go to the toolbar under the full view and click Create task.
The Details palette opens.
Click Task details and enter detailed information about this task.

Click SAVE.
This creates the task, saving the view (see step 1) together with the task. The Responsible person and the people behind Email CC addresses get emails informing them of the new task.

Saving a view for a task
Whenever you save changes in the details of a task, the program saves the current view of the full view together with the task. But you can also change the view saved for a task.
To use the Bimplus portal to save a new view for a task
Click the task on the task board or in the Task navigator palette.
You can see the view currently saved for this task in full view.
- Change the view.
- Click Task details. Go to the preview and click EDIT.
Click SAVE.
The Responsible person and the people behind Email CC addresses get emails informing them of the changes in the task.
Importing and exporting tasks
To communicate with your planning partners, you can directly import any task in BCF format (BIM collaboration format) or export any Bimplus task in BCF format.
Important!
The project must include the associated model with the objects described in the task. Otherwise, the program can neither use nor display BCF files correctly. Therefore, load the model into your project before you import BCF files.
To use the Bimplus portal to import a task in BCF format
Go to the toolbar of the task board and click Import BCF file to Bimplus in the upper-right area.
The Open dialog box opens. Select the BCF file containing the task you want to import. The extension of this file is *.BCFZIP.
Click Open.
This creates a new task, writing the contents of the BCF file to this task.
To use the Bimplus portal to export a task in BCF format
Select the task you want to export to a BCF file.
To do this, click the task on the task board or in the Task navigator palette.
Go to the toolbar of the task board and click Export task to BCF file in the upper-right area.
The BCF export dialog box opens.
Select the BCF format (BCF 2.0 or BCF 2.1).
Decide whether you want to download the file immediately or make it available for other planning partners so that they can download it.
Download
Click DOWNLOAD and save the file in any folder.Or:
Share file
Enter the email addresses of the recipients and click SEND. The recipients get emails informing them of the BCF file that is available for download on Bimplus.
Exporting the task list
It is often difficult to keep track of tasks, in particular, with a complex task list. Therefore, you can export the complete task list of a Bimplus project in Excel format.
To use the Bimplus portal to export the task list of a Bimplus project in Excel format
Arrange the columns of the task board in the sequence in which you want to display the columns in Excel.
Sort the rows of the task list in the sequence in which you want to display the rows in Excel.
To do this, click the header of the column you want to use to sort the contents of the task list alphabetically or numerically in ascending or descending order.
Go to the toolbar of the task board and click Export all tasks to Excel file in the upper-right area.
- Save the file in any folder or open the file in Excel.
Deleting tasks
To use the Bimplus portal to delete a task from a Bimplus project
Click the task you want to delete on the task board or in the Task navigator palette.
Click
Delete task in the Details palette.Click DELETE to confirm the prompt.
ATTENTION!
This deletes the task including all spots and further information for good.
